Transaction 75429162ed727427806fa941fdc5d2686bdb3f53a9ddbc5033150db83588702f
1 Input
1 Output
-
75429162ed727427806fa941fdc5d2686bdb3f53a9ddbc5033150db83588702f:0
- value
- 50050000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 279dc1d4e4db9877a5ee0e609f3f0a7a0739d21d OP_EQUALVERIFY OP_CHECKSIG
- address
- 14cULeABbWMn5DpTmgaqhzVFXHyaA18xyh